117.info
人生若只如初见

performClick()方法的使用

performClick()方法是View类的一个方法,用于模拟用户点击该View的操作。

该方法的使用可以分为两种情况:

  1. 直接调用performClick()方法:可以通过直接调用View的performClick()方法来模拟用户点击该View。例如:
Button button = findViewById(R.id.button);
button.performClick();
  1. 重写View的performClick()方法:如果想要在用户点击View时执行一些特定的操作,可以重写View的performClick()方法。例如:
public class MyView extends View {
// ...
@Override
public boolean performClick() {
// 执行一些特定的操作
// ...
// 调用父类的performClick()方法,以便继续处理点击事件
return super.performClick();
}
}

在重写performClick()方法时,可以先执行一些特定的操作,然后再调用父类的performClick()方法,以便继续处理点击事件。同时,需要注意在重写performClick()方法时,要返回super.performClick()的值,以确保点击事件的正常处理。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fefd1AzsLBwNXA1M.html

推荐文章

  • 计划任务 SchedulerFactoryBean 配置

    要配置计划任务的SchedulerFactoryBean,可以按照以下步骤进行:1. 导入所需的依赖:首先确保在项目的构建文件中导入了spring-context-support和quartz依赖,以使...

  • 在OneDrive中删除文件或文件夹

    要在OneDrive中删除文件或文件夹,请按照以下步骤操作:1. 打开OneDrive应用或访问OneDrive网站(https://onedrive.live.com)。2. 导航到你要删除的文件或文件夹...

  • 在OneDrive中还原已删除文件或文件夹

    在OneDrive中,您可以还原已删除的文件或文件夹。下面是操作步骤:1. 打开OneDrive网页版,登录您的账户。2. 在左侧导航栏中,点击“回收站”选项。3. 在回收站中...

  • web自动化测试工具有哪些

    以下是一些常见的Web自动化测试工具:1. Selenium:一个流行的Web自动化测试框架,支持多种编程语言,包括Java、Python、C#等。2. WebDriver:Selenium的一部分,...